Least Common Multiple of 11990 and 11997 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 11990 and 11997, than apply into the LCM equation.

GCF(11990,11997) = 1
LCM(11990,11997) = ( 11990 × 11997) / 1
LCM(11990,11997) = 143844030 / 1
LCM(11990,11997) = 143844030
